K8S:未来网络的引领之星
本文共计1833个文字,预计阅读时间需要8分钟。
在当今数字化时代,网络技术的发展日新月异,Kubernetes(K8S)作为一种强大的容器编排平台,正引领着未来网络的发展方向。将围绕 K8S 经典,探讨其在未来网络中的重要以及如何利用它来构建更高效、可靠和灵活的网络架构。
K8S 经典的魅力
K8S 经典是 Kubernetes 的原始版本,它提供了一组强大的工具和功能,用于管理和调度容器化应用程序。以下是 K8S 经典的一些核心特点:
1. 容器编排:K8S 能够自动管理容器的部署、扩展、迁移和故障恢复,确保应用程序的高可用和弹。
2. 资源管理:它可以精确地分配和管理计算、内存、存储等资源,提高资源利用率,避免资源浪费。
3. 服务发现和负载均衡:K8S 内置了服务发现机制,能够自动发现和负载均衡容器化应用程序,提供高可靠的服务访问。
4. 自动扩容和缩容:根据应用程序的需求,K8S 可以自动增加或减少容器的数量,实现弹扩展,满足业务的突发需求。
5. 版本控制和回滚:K8S 支持应用程序的版本控制和回滚,方便快速迭代和修复问题。
这些特点使得 K8S 经典成为构建现代网络的理想选择,它能够帮助企业实现网络的自动化、高效化和智能化管理。
未来网络的需求
随着互联网的不断发展,未来网络将面临更多的挑战和需求,例如:
1. 大规模的容器化应用部署:未来的网络将承载越来越多的容器化应用程序,需要一种强大的工具来管理和调度这些应用。
2. 动态的网络拓扑:网络拓扑结构将变得更加动态和灵活,需要能够快速适应变化的网络架构。
3. 智能网络管理:网络需要具备智能的管理功能,能够自动发现和解决问题,提高网络的可靠和能。
4. 多云环境的支持:企业将越来越多地采用多云环境,需要网络能够在不同云之间实现平滑的迁移和管理。
5. 安全和隐私保护:网络安全和隐私保护将成为至关重要的问题,需要采取措施确保数据的安全。
K8S 经典以其强大的容器管理能力和灵活,正好满足了未来网络的这些需求。
K8S 经典在未来网络中的应用
1. 容器化网络服务:将网络功能(如防火墙、负载均衡器等)容器化,并使用 K8S 进行管理和调度。这样可以实现网络服务的快速部署和扩展,提高网络的灵活和可管理。
2. 网络功能虚拟化(NFV):K8S 可以与 NFV 技术结合,将网络功能从硬件设备中分离出来,运行在虚拟机或容器中,实现网络的虚拟化和云化。
3. 多云网络管理:在多云环境中,K8S 可以帮助企业实现不同云之间的网络资源共享和管理,确保网络的一致和可扩展。
4. 智能网络监控和自动化:通过集成 K8S 与网络监控工具和自动化脚本,可以实现网络的实时监控、故障诊断和自动修复,提高网络的可靠和能。
5. 安全策略管理:利用 K8S 的配置管理功能,可以轻松地部署和管理网络安全策略,确保网络的安全。
挑战与应对
尽管 K8S 经典在未来网络中具有巨大的潜力,但也面临一些挑战,例如:
1. 学习曲线:K8S 相对较新,学习曲线可能对一些用户来说具有一定的难度。随着社区的不断发展和文档的完善,学习资源也在不断增加。
2. 复杂:K8S 本身具有一定的复杂,需要对容器技术、网络知识和操作系统有深入的了解。在实施 K8S 时,需要谨慎规划和配置。
3. 监控和管理:确保 K8S 集群的健康运行和能监控是至关重要的。需要选择合适的监控工具和指标,并建立有效的监控和管理机制。
4. 安全风险:由于 K8S 管理着容器化应用程序和网络资源,安全风险也需要得到重视。需要采取适当的安全措施,如访问控制、数据加密等。
为了应对这些挑战,可以采取以下措施:
1. 提供培训和教育资源:帮助用户更好地了解 K8S 技术,提供详细的文档、教程和在线培训课程。
2. 简化部署和管理:开发易于使用的工具和界面,简化 K8S 的部署和管理过程,降低用户的学习成本。
3. 监控和管理工具:选择功能强大且易于使用的监控工具,提供实时的能指标和警报功能。
4. 强化安全措施:加强 K8S 集群的安全配置,实施访问控制、数据加密等安全策略,确保网络的安全。
5. 社区支持:积极参与 K8S 社区,与其他用户分享经验和最佳实践,获取技术支持和建议。
Kubernetes 经典以其强大的容器管理能力和对未来网络需求的适应能力,正引领着未来网络的发展方向。通过利用 K8S 经典,可以构建更高效、可靠和灵活的网络架构,满足大规模容器化应用部署、动态网络拓扑、智能网络管理等需求。尽管面临一些挑战,但通过适当的措施和社区的支持,可以有效地应对这些挑战。
在未来的网络世界中,K8S 经典将继续发挥重要作用,帮助企业实现数字化转型,推动网络技术的不断发展。让我们紧跟 K8S 经典的步伐,引领未来网络的潮流,开创更加美好的网络未来。